An in-development library to provide effective access to all features of the FXOS8700CQ on the FRDM-K64F mbed-enabled development board. As of 28 May 2014 1325EDT, the code should be generally usable and modifiable.

Revision:
5:d1fa77b56bc7
Parent:
4:e2fe752b881e
diff -r e2fe752b881e -r d1fa77b56bc7 FXOS8700CQ.h
--- a/FXOS8700CQ.h	Tue Jun 03 19:02:19 2014 +0000
+++ b/FXOS8700CQ.h	Thu Dec 06 20:50:52 2018 +0000
@@ -160,6 +160,10 @@
     * @return 2, 4, or 8, depending on part configuration; 0 on error
     */
     uint8_t get_accel_scale(void);
+    
+    void read_regs(int reg_addr, uint8_t* data, int len);
+    
+    void write_regs(uint8_t* data, int len);
 
 
 
@@ -169,8 +173,7 @@
     bool enabled; // keep track of enable bit of device
 
     // I2C helper methods
-    void read_regs(int reg_addr, uint8_t* data, int len);
-    void write_regs(uint8_t* data, int len);
+
 
 };